EMF is a type of invisible energy field that is created whenever electricity flows through a conductor, such as a wire or a circuit Common sources of EMF include power lines, appliances, and electronic devices Radiation, on the other hand, refers to the emission of energy in the form of electromagnetic waves or particles While not all EMF is considered harmful, certain types of radiation, such as ionizing radiation from X-rays and gamma rays, have been proven to cause damage to living tissue.
One of the primary concerns regarding EMF and radiation exposure is the potential link to cancer Several studies have suggested that long-term exposure to high levels of EMF may increase the risk of developing certain types of cancer, such as leukemia and brain tumors However, the scientific community is divided on the issue, with some experts dismissing these claims as unfounded and inconclusive.
The World Health Organization (WHO) has classified EMF as a possible carcinogen, based on limited evidence linking long-term exposure to an increased risk of cancer This classification has sparked widespread concern among the public, leading to calls for stricter regulations on EMF-emitting devices and infrastructure Despite these warnings, the overall consensus among health authorities is that the current levels of EMF exposure from everyday devices are unlikely to cause serious harm to the general population.

One of the most contentious issues surrounding EMF and radiation is the debate over electromagnetic hypersensitivity (EHS) EHS is a condition in which individuals experience a range of symptoms, such as headaches, dizziness, and fatigue, in response to exposure to EMF-emitting devices While some studies have suggested a possible link between EHS and EMF exposure, others argue that the symptoms are more likely due to psychological factors or other medical conditions.
